Bus Stop:
21 ST/QUEENS PLAZA NORTH
Buses en-route:
Q66 FLUSHING MAIN ST STA via NORTHERN BL
- 2 minutes,1 stop away (at terminal, scheduled to depart at 12:25 AM) Vehicle 538
- 36 minutes,4.8 miles away (+ layover, scheduled to depart terminal at 12:55 AM) Vehicle 567
Q69 JACKSON HEIGHTS 82 ST via 21 ST via DITMARS BL
- 25 minutes,3.4 miles away (+ layover, scheduled to depart terminal at 12:45 AM) Vehicle 4491
Q102 ROOSEVELT ISLAND via 31 ST
- 5 minutes,0.6 miles away, ~5 passengers on vehicle Vehicle 9246